Vagina Variations: It's All About Diversity
Just like snowflakes, vaginas come in all shapes, sizes, and colors. Some are short and compact, while others are long and tapering. Some have a more prominent labia, while others have a less noticeable one. And, guess what? It's all perfectly normal! The vagina is like a fingerprint – unique to each individual.

What Influences Vagina Appearance?
Now, let's talk about what actually affects the way a vagina looks. Genetics play a significant role, just like with any other physical characteristic. Hormonal changes during puberty, menopause, or pregnancy can also cause changes in vaginal appearance. And, of course, aging is a natural part of life that can lead to subtle changes over time.
But, here's the cool part: our vaginas are incredibly resilient. They can stretch and expand during sex, childbirth, or other activities, and then return to their normal shape afterward.
